Does tight junction prevent leakage?

Tight junctions, also known as occluding junctions or zonulae occludentes (singular, zonula occludens) are multiprotein junctional complexes whose canonical function is to prevent leakage of solutes and water and seals between the epithelial cells.

Are tight junctions watertight?

Tight junctions form a water tight seal and prevent material from passing between cells. Desmosomes form links between cells, and provide a connection between intermediate filaments of the cell cytoskeletons of adjacent cells.

How many types of cell junctions are there?

Cell junctions fall into three functional classes: occluding junctions, anchoring junctions, and communicating junctions.

Do all cells have gap junctions?

Gap junctions occur in virtually all tissues of the body, with the exception of adult fully developed skeletal muscle and mobile cell types such as sperm or erythrocytes. Gap junctions are not found in simpler organisms such as sponges and slime molds. A gap junction may also be called a nexus or macula communicans.

How many layers thick would Simple squamous epithelial tissue be?

Simple squamous epithelium consists of thin, flattened cells, that are one layer thick and allow for the easy movement of substances.

What type of cell junctions are found in cardiac muscle tissue?

Cardiac muscle cells are equipped with three distinct types of intercellular junction–gap junctions, “spot” desmosomes, and “sheet” desmosomes (or fasciae adherentes)–located in a specialized portion of the plasma membrane, the intercalated disk.

What is middle lamella in cell wall?

The middle lamella is a layer that cements together the primary cell walls of two adjoining plant cells. It is the first formed layer to be deposited at the time of cytokinesis. The cell plate that is formed during cell division itself develops into middle lamella or lamellum.

What is an adhesion belt?

Adhesion belt, commonly known as the intermediate junction, refers to the formation of a continuous band-like structure between adjacent cells. The interaction of actin and cadherin forms an adhesion belt that binds two cells. And it is primarily responsible for regulating cell structure.

What is a gap junction structure?

Gap junctions are aggregates of intercellular channels that permit direct cell–cell transfer of ions and small molecules. Initially described as low-resistance ion pathways joining excitable cells (nerve and muscle), gap junctions are found joining virtually all cells in solid tissues.

How many plasmodesmata are present in a plant cell?

A typical plant cell may have between 1,000 and 100,000 plasmodesmata connecting it with adjacent cells equating to between 1 and 10 per µm2.

What do you mean by plasmodesmata Class 9?

Plasmodesmata are microscopic channels present in all plant cells. They are cylindrical shaped, membrane-lined channels, which play a vital role in intercellular communication.
